I know it's been at least a week since I have last written and for that, I am sorry. Since I last wrote not very much has happened. I had to get another transfusion because my counts were low....again. I had to get two bags of blood. My heart rate has been slowly going down. The last time I saw it it was around 100 so that is a lot better than the 128 or 180 that it has been.
I didn't get to go to the clinical trial again because of my counts being low. It's a little disappointing because of that fact that I want this cancer to leave. I also haven't had chemo in a little over a month. Thankfully, knock on wood, none of my tumors have grown or spread so as much as that's a good thing, I still wish I had the chemo to keep the pain at bay.
Saturday and last night I was in excruciating pain. Saturday I had pain in my lower back (where my tumors are) and I had pain in my hip and knee (because of the nerve that is being compressed). I was bawling my eyes out and on the verge of hyperventilating. I took my instant release morphine (it's supposed to kick in after 15 minutes) and I took some Aleve PM and rubbed some Tiger Balm and Icy Hot on the areas and used a heating pad on my back and after a couple of hours the pain finally went away. I think it was around 2:00 AM when my step mom and Travis finally got me to sleep.
Last night I again had pain, but this time it was in my hip and lower back. I did the Icy Hot roll on again and I took my instant release pills (this time I had around 12 of them since they are only 15 MG), I also took some Aleve PM and I again used the heating pad. I was crying so loud this time because I was in more pain than last time. I was worried my neighbors were thinking I was being murdered or something with how loud I was. Thankfully after about two hours the pain went away, This time it was a reasonable hour, I think it was around midnight. Instead of reclining in the recliner and sleeping there like I did the last time, I slept sitting up because when I would recline my hip would start to hurt again. I was kind of pissed because I wanted to sleep in our bed, but hey as long as I wasn't in pain I didn't care.
So yah, that's what's been going on. Nothing too exciting, just trying to keep my sanity.
